U.S. patent number D816,267 [Application Number D/569,896] was granted by the patent office on 2018-04-24 for vaporization device. This patent grant is currently assigned to DB INNOVATION INC.. The grantee listed for this patent is Thomas Fornarelli. Invention is credited to Thomas Fornarelli.

Description



FIG. 1 is a perspective view showing the bottom end of a vaporization device showing of my new design;

FIG. 2 is a perspective view showing the top end of my new design;

FIG. 3 is a bottom elevational view of my new design;

FIG. 4 is a bottom elevational view of my new design;

FIG. 5 is a left side elevational view of my new design, the appearance of any portion of the article between the break lines forms no part of the claimed design;

FIG. 6 is a right side elevational view of my new design, the appearance of any portion of the article between the break lines forms no part of the claimed design;

FIG. 7 is a front plan view of my new design, the appearance of any portion of the article between the break lines forms no part of the claimed design; and,

FIG. 8 is a back plan view of my new design, the appearance of any portion of the article between the break lines forms no part of the claimed design.

A broken line showing is for illustrative purposes only and forms no part of the claimed design.

A break line indicates indeterminate length.
